About Median Home Value
Highland County, Virginia has a median home value of $200,000, ranking #1,404 of 3,222 counties nationwide — 29.1% below the national value of $281,900. Within Virginia, it ranks #94 of 133. This places it in the 56th percentile nationally.
The median value of owner-occupied housing units. Source: U.S. Census Bureau, American Community Survey 2024 5-Year Estimates. All values are estimates derived from survey samples and are subject to margin of error. For more information, see our methodology.
